....just got a call from our Sheriff's Dept. with an offer to be their on-call SWAT Medic. It consists of training with the team once a week, going with the team on search warrants, stand-offs, etc. Will be issued SWAT gear, medical supplies and a hand gun for self-protection. I'm always on the look-out for adrenaline and always want to help folks and what a way to combine the two. Just thought I would share this bit of news for the LEO's we have around the forum and emergency workers. Wish me luck!
